Nelson at her 70th birthday party, London, March 2006| Sheila Mary Nelson (5 March 1936 – 16 November 2020) was an English musician, music educator, writer and composer. She had played with the English Chamber Orchestra, the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ra and the Menuhin Festival Orchestra but was best known as a violin and viola teacher. She is usually referred to as Sheila Nelson but appears in her published works as Sheila M. Nelson. Provided by Wikipedia
